Why Bread Crumbs Make a Difference in Sausage Rolls

Alright, guys, let's talk about the secret weapon: bread crumbs. You might be wondering, why bother? Well, let me tell you, bread crumbs are game-changers! They're not just some random addition; they play a crucial role in enhancing both the texture and the flavor of your sausage rolls. First off, they soak up all those lovely juices released by the sausage meat as it cooks. This helps prevent the dreaded soggy bottom and ensures a perfectly crisp, golden-brown crust. Secondly, they add a delightful lightness and fluffiness to the filling, preventing it from being dense and heavy. And finally, they contribute a subtle but noticeable layer of flavor, tying all the ingredients together into a harmonious bite. Types of Bread Crumbs to Use

When it comes to bread crumbs, you have options, my friends! Each type brings its own unique character to the party. Let's break down the most popular choices so you can decide which one will best complement your sausage rolls. First up, we have plain bread crumbs. These are the workhorses of the bread crumb world – versatile and reliable. They have a neutral flavor, making them perfect for letting the sausage flavor shine. They're typically made from dried, toasted bread, and they provide that crucial texture we're after. Then there are Panko bread crumbs. These are a Japanese variety that is super popular. Panko crumbs are made from bread without crusts, resulting in a lighter, flakier texture. They absorb less oil, leading to a crispier finished product. Panko bread crumbs are the go-to for many people because they create an incredibly satisfying crunch. Lastly, we have flavored bread crumbs. These are for those who want to add an extra layer of flavor complexity. You can find varieties like Italian-seasoned, garlic and herb, or even spicy. While these can be fun, be mindful that they could potentially overpower the sausage flavor, so a little experimentation may be necessary. For your first try, I'd suggest going with plain bread crumbs to appreciate the true sausage roll experience.

Gathering Your Ingredients

Alright, let's gather our troops – the ingredients! To make these amazing sausage rolls, you'll need the following: one package of puff pastry, which is the base of our deliciousness, so make sure you choose a good one; one pound of good-quality sausage meat, the heart and soul of our rolls, which is going to bring that savory goodness; one cup of bread crumbs, your chosen variety to enhance the texture and absorb the juices; one small onion, finely chopped; this is going to add a lovely depth of flavor; two cloves of garlic, minced; these little guys are packed with flavor and provide a wonderful aroma; fresh herbs, such as parsley or thyme, finely chopped. These will give a fresh, aromatic lift; one egg, beaten, to create that golden glaze; and salt and pepper, to season your masterpiece. Remember that the quality of your ingredients directly impacts the end result, so choose wisely. Fresh herbs and good sausage meat make a huge difference, guys! Step-by-Step Guide to Making Sausage Rolls

Okay, team, let's get cooking! This is where we bring everything together, and with a few simple steps, we'll transform our ingredients into golden, flaky perfection. Trust me, the aroma alone will have your mouth watering. First, in a large bowl, combine the sausage meat, bread crumbs, chopped onion, minced garlic, and fresh herbs. Use your hands or a fork to mix everything together until it's evenly combined. Now, don't be shy; get in there and make sure everything's well-mixed. Season generously with salt and pepper to taste. Remember, seasoning is key, so don't skimp! Next, on a lightly floured surface, gently unfold your puff pastry sheet. If it's frozen, make sure to thaw it according to package instructions. Now, evenly spread the sausage mixture over the puff pastry, leaving about an inch of space on one of the long edges. This is important for sealing the roll. Brush the uncovered edge of the pastry with the beaten egg. This acts as a glue, ensuring a tight seal. Carefully roll up the pastry, starting from the edge with the filling, into a log. Use your hands to gently tighten the roll as you go. Once rolled, brush the entire log with the remaining beaten egg for that glorious golden glaze. This is going to make them look so pretty! Cut the log into individual rolls, about 1-2 inches thick. Place the rolls on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per, making sure they're not too close together. This gives them room to puff up. Bake in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for about 20-25 minutes, or until the pastry is golden brown and the filling is cooked through. The internal temperature of the sausage meat should reach 160°F (71°C). Once baked, let the sausage rolls cool slightly before serving. They're best enjoyed warm, but trust me, they'll disappear fast no matter what! And there you have it: perfectly baked sausage rolls, ready to enjoy. Serve them as a snack, appetizer, or even a light meal. Pair them with your favorite dipping sauce, such as ketchup, mustard, or a spicy chutney. Enjoy your culinary success, guys!

Tips and Tricks for Sausage Roll Success

Alright, let's get you ready for sausage roll greatness. Here are some pro tips to help you achieve the perfect sausage roll every single time. First off, make sure your puff pastry is cold. Cold pastry is crucial for creating those amazing, flaky layers we all love. Before you start assembling, ensure the pastry is well-chilled. You can even pop it back in the fridge if it starts to get too warm. Secondly, don't overwork the sausage mixture. Overmixing can lead to tough sausage rolls. Mix the ingredients just until they're combined. Be gentle, and your rolls will be tender and delicious. Thirdly, seal those edges properly. The egg wash is your best friend here! Ensure you brush the edges with egg wash and press firmly to seal the rolls tightly. This will prevent the filling from leaking out during baking. Also, don't overcrowd the baking sheet. Give those sausage rolls some space to breathe! Overcrowding can lead to soggy bottoms and uneven baking. Bake them in batches if necessary. And finally, let them cool slightly before eating. I know it's tempting to dive right in, but letting them cool a bit allows the flavors to meld and the pastry to set. It'll be worth the wait, I promise!

Variations and Creative Twists

Ready to get creative, guys? Once you've mastered the classic sausage roll with bread crumbs, the world is your oyster! Here are some fun variations and creative twists to elevate your sausage roll game. First, try different types of sausage meat. Experiment with Italian sausage, chorizo, or even a vegetarian sausage alternative. Each option will bring a unique flavor profile to the rolls. You can also add cheeses to the filling. Grated cheddar, mozzarella, or even a creamy goat cheese will add richness and depth to the flavor. Don't be afraid to experiment with different combinations! Spice things up by adding some heat. A pinch of red pepper flakes, a dash of cayenne pepper, or a spoonful of your favorite hot sauce will add a pleasant kick. For a touch of sweetness, consider adding caramelized onions to the sausage mixture. The sweetness of the onions will balance the savory flavors beautifully. You can also incorporate other vegetables into the filling. Finely chopped mushrooms, bell peppers, or spinach will add nutrients and texture. Get creative with your herbs and spices. Try adding fresh rosemary, sage, or even a pinch of smoked paprika for a unique flavor profile. Remember, cooking is about having fun and experimenting. Storage and Reheating Tips

So you've made a batch of incredible sausage rolls, but you can't eat them all at once? No worries, here's how to store and reheat them so they stay delicious. To store, let the sausage rolls cool completely. Then, place them in an airtight container or a resealable bag. They will keep in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. For longer storage, you can freeze the sausage rolls. Wrap each roll individually in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e bag or container. They will keep in the freezer for up to 2 months. To reheat, the best method is in the oven.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C), and place the sausage rolls on a baking sheet. Bake for 10-15 minutes, or until heated through and the pastry is crispy. This method will restore the flakiness and crispiness. You can also reheat them in a toaster oven for a smaller batch. If you're short on time, you can microwave the sausage rolls. However, be aware that the pastry might not be as crispy. Microwave them in short intervals, checking frequently to prevent overcooking. Always handle the heated sausage rolls with care, as they will be hot.
